Based on the data from the years 2003 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 11. The highest number of reported fires - 24 took place in 2011, and the least - 1 in 2004. The data has a growing trend.
30.4% incidents where reported in the morning and 69.6% in the evening. The most fires (17.3%) took place on Thursday, and the least (10.1%) on Wednesday.
According to the 168 incident reports from years 2003 - 2018 most fires (14.3%) took place during April, and the least (2.4%) in August.
Out of all 547 cases reported during the years 2003 - 2018, the most belonged to the categories: Fire (30.7%), Rescue & EMS (28.2%), and Good Intent Call (18.1%).
When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Structure Fires (61.9%), and Outside Fires (19.6%).
